ad5320怎么就没有输出呢?求戳盲点
本帖最后由 ultramanshey 于 2013-4-10 21:05 编辑最近在ad5320上花了不少时间,按理说这是一块极其简单的芯片,不能让它正常输出实在是令人费解。
我做了如下工作:
1.确定管教没有虚焊,短路;
2.用示波器检测每一个输入端的信号都正常,而且能达到要求的幅值;
3.输出Vout和地之间有1.8KΩ的负载;
现在的情况是用示波器检测输出始终保持在4~6mV不变。
附上我的时序图
图中D1为时钟10KHz,D3D4为两个通道的Din信号,我给了FFF满程控制字,为了能够直观的观测信号是不是正常(虽然结果让我很受伤),D5是SYNC信号
SYNC拉低为16个周期。
我一定是遇到盲点了,还请有经验的还请有经验的大神一起探讨探讨,戳戳我的盲点。
这么小一个DAC居然花了4天时间都搞不定,实在是羞愧不已。 {:shy:} 电路图呢亲 BBC 发表于 2013-4-10 21:01 static/image/common/back.gif
电路图呢亲
不好意思,一激动忘记了。。。已附在一楼~~~ {:smile:} 暂时没发现问题哦~~ BBC 发表于 2013-4-10 22:37 static/image/common/back.gif
暂时没发现问题哦~~
嗯,我也是想不出,到底什么地方出了问题。。。我能想到的都试过了,今天晚上还尝试了不同的验证方法。。。我都怀疑片子是不是坏了,转念一想不太可能。。。焦虑。。。 ultramanshey 发表于 2013-4-10 23:08 static/image/common/back.gif
嗯,我也是想不出,到底什么地方出了问题。。。我能想到的都试过了,今天晚上还尝试了不同的验证方法。。 ...
芯片是什么封装呀~是不是调转180度了... BBC 发表于 2013-4-10 23:36 static/image/common/back.gif
芯片是什么封装呀~是不是调转180度了...
封装时SOT-23,焊接顺序应该是对的。。。我是按照数据手册上来焊的
VOUT外面接的那两个电阻值为啥那么小?这个值是不是太小了阿? 如果硬件没问题的话,可能是SYNC信号的问题吧,数据进入DAC的Register后,没有更新DAC的输出。 示波器好高级哦 ultramanshey 发表于 2013-4-11 10:01 static/image/common/back.gif
封装时SOT-23,焊接顺序应该是对的。。。我是按照数据手册上来焊的
{:shy:} 调转过来试一下呗...... tangkuan660 发表于 2013-4-11 10:18 static/image/common/back.gif
VOUT外面接的那两个电阻值为啥那么小?这个值是不是太小了阿?
我把可变电阻加到2K了,效果还是一样。。。 hjf2002_hk 发表于 2013-4-11 10:29 static/image/common/back.gif
如果硬件没问题的话,可能是SYNC信号的问题吧,数据进入DAC的Register后,没有更新DAC的输出。 ...
我昨天晚上想了想,现在这么下来无非就是两个情况,要么硬件要么sync信号的问题,硬件的话,电路什么的我是想不出有哪里需要改进了,除非片子本身坏了。。。我现在已经没有库存了。。。而且我也不知道如何检测片子是好是坏,sync信号我换过两种,第一种是图示的信号,一直保持在高位,要用的时候拉低16个周期,第二种是一直保持在低位,要用的时候拉高一个周期,应该能保证33ns的拉高需求的,两种下来都没有进展。。。整个过程我倒是挺享受的,但是出不来结果也挺头疼的。。。
另外,我想问问,我用示波器一端接Vout,接地夹子接地,这样的测法有问题吗? BBC 发表于 2013-4-11 12:35 static/image/common/back.gif
调转过来试一下呗......
试了,今天早上试了,还是不行。。。应该不是这个问题。。。 时序是按照手册上来的?
可否测下进入DIN的数据是不是你所期望的16位数据呢?说不定是进入DIN的16位数据有问题呢? mayo20102012 发表于 2013-4-11 14:45 static/image/common/back.gif
时序是按照手册上来的?
可否测下进入DIN的数据是不是你所期望的16位数据呢?说不定是进入DIN的16位数据有 ...
检查了,我用示波器的探头把三个端口都检查了一遍,上拉幅值是2.8V,下拉幅值是80mV,我想应该满足datasheet上的要求了,datasheet上写的是下边沿是0.8V,上边沿是2.4V,这应该没什么问题。。。
我现在还想到一点,我看到datasheet里面的管脚温度不超过220°C,会不会是我的电烙铁太烫了。。。{:sweat:} ultramanshey 发表于 2013-4-11 14:38 static/image/common/back.gif
我昨天晚上想了想,现在这么下来无非就是两个情况,要么硬件要么sync信号的问题,硬件的话,电路什么的我 ...
{:titter:} 会不会是示波器的问题......设置、连接、档位等...... BBC 发表于 2013-4-11 15:09 static/image/common/back.gif
会不会是示波器的问题......设置、连接、档位等......
这个我试过了。。。我把探头接在电源上,显示正常的。。。 ultramanshey 发表于 2013-4-11 15:02 static/image/common/back.gif
检查了,我用示波器的探头把三个端口都检查了一遍,上拉幅值是2.8V,下拉幅值是80mV,我想应该满足datash ...
换快芯片 试试? mayo20102012 发表于 2013-4-11 15:24 static/image/common/back.gif
换快芯片 试试?
芯片估计明天到货。。。明天再试吧。。。 感谢每一位帮助我的亲们,谢谢你们提供了这么多思路帮我逐一排除了所有可能的情况。。。于是我今天去偷偷搞来一片别人用过的片子,然后。。。bingo,调出来了。。。衷心的感谢~~~~ 楼主 是IC本身的问题吗? 孤独飞行 发表于 2013-5-20 14:53 static/image/common/back.gif
楼主 是IC本身的问题吗?
是的,这个问题我已经检查出来了,是IC本身坏了,换了一块新的就好了 能发一份程序给我验证一下我的IC吗?调了几天也是没输出。那个带记号的地方是1脚吗?谢谢 qq137 8 811 047 孤独飞行 发表于 2013-5-20 15:12 static/image/common/back.gif
能发一份程序给我验证一下我的IC吗?调了几天也是没输出。那个带记号的地方是1脚吗?谢谢 qq137 8 811 04 ...
对,没错
页:
[1]